Conversational Swahili FAQ

What are the basics of Conversational Swahili for beginners?

The basics of Conversational Swahili for beginners include greetings like 'Hujambo?' (Hello), common phrases such as 'Asante' (Thank you), 'Samahani' (Excuse me/Sorry), and simple sentences to express needs or ask questions like 'Ninaweza kupata ...?' (Can I get ...?). Beginners should also focus on learning numbers, days of the week, and essential verbs such as 'kula' (to eat), 'kunywa' (to drink), and 'kwenda' (to go). Practicing pronunciation, listening to native speakers, and learning basic grammar concepts are crucial for building a strong foundation in conversational Swahili.

About Conversational Swahili & Conversational Swahili Tutoring

Conversational Swahili, also known as Kiswahili sanifu, is a form of the Swahili language that is used in everyday communication and social interactions among speakers in Eastern Africa. It serves as a lingua franca in the region, connecting people across different ethnic and linguistic backgrounds, and is officially recognized in countries such as Kenya, Tanzania, and the Democratic Republic of the Congo.

The language is characterized by its Bantu roots, with a significant number of loanwords from Arabic due to historical trade relations and cultural exchanges. Moreover, it also incorporates elements from colonial languages such as English and Portuguese. This blend gives conversational Swahili its unique lexicon and grammatical structure, which is less formal and more flexible than the literary language.

Types of Conversational Swahili can vary depending on regional dialects and levels of formality. The most widely understood and spoken version is Kiunguja, the dialect of Zanzibar, which forms the basis of standard Swahili. However, informal conversational Swahili may display more local variations and influences. For instance, Sheng, a dynamic urban slang in Kenya, incorporates English, Swahili, and other Kenyan languages, reflecting the evolving nature of the language among youth in urban areas.

Related entities to Conversational Swahili include Swahili literature, music, media, and education. Each of these entities employs a version of Swahili that relates to the context, with conversational Swahili being more prevalent in informal contexts and popular culture.

When learning conversational Swahili, the most common concepts include greetings (salamu), politeness expressions (tafadhali for "please" and asante for "thank you"), and common phrases for everyday situations like shopping, dining, or asking for directions. Basic verb conjugations and noun classes are also central to the language, though they can be simplified in casual conversations.

The most difficult concepts in conversational Swahili typically include mastering the noun class system, which is extensive and affects agreement in verbs, adjectives, and pronouns. Additionally, verb tenses, aspect, and mood can present challenges due to the intricate affixes that modify the verb stem to convey different meanings. To overcome these difficulties, ample practice and exposure to the language in context are recommended.
